Hanging out at the Dixie Deer Classic in Raleigh, NC. Our guests today are from the Wake County Wildlife Club who runs the DDC, but more importantly they are hunters. Mike Clancy and Jay Adcock. Mike is a die-hard whitetailer, and Jay “Turkey Leg” Adcock has the Disease, the turkey hunting disease. As a matter of fact during this podcast Mike and I think we might have to hit Jay with the AED, his eyes roll into the back of his head and he speaks in tongues when the subject of Meleagris gallopavo, comes up. This was a fun one, two great dudes. God Bless America!!
